Crawl Space Encapsulation in Hampton

In the greater Virginia Beach area, many of the homes are built with crawl space areas and not basements. For a long time, these were constructed with vents to the outside where were intended to help air flow into the space and keep it dry. Unfortunately, the opposite is usually what happens. Having open vents allows water to get in when it rains or snows and then it never leaves which causes the humidity levels to stay high which can foster the growth of mildew. We have found that up to ½ of the air in your home comes up through the crawl space so ensuring this area is protected from the elements and keeping the humidity levels low can improve the overall air quality in your home.

We have been working on crawl spaces since we opened our doors and we know the most efficient way to seal them off and control high humidity. This is done using a process called encapsulation which is the installation of a series of vapor barriers, occasionally installed with insulation products, which are heavy duty plastic and vinyl sheets as well as vent covers and a heavy duty door that can seal the area completely and prevent any unwanted moisture from entering. This will also prevent bugs and animals from getting in your crawl space which will keep any items there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Once the crawl space is protected, if you need it we can install a series of floor jacks to repair sinking floors above the crawl space.

Foundation Settlement Repair Hampton

The foundation of your home is easily one of the most important parts. It not only supports the structure itself but it also is the basement walls. If there are foundation problems, normally they will present themselves as diagonal cracks in the outside brickwork, horizontal cracks that run along the foundation or across the basement walls. Sometimes, you will see that the doors and windows will stick when you open or close them or there may be cracks at the corners of them. You may not think these problems seem problematic at first, each of them are indicative of a sinking or settling foundation which should be looked at by a professional for particular problems and determine if a repair needs to be in place.

It is good that many foundation problems stem from similar issues and our experts are very good at noticing these issues. We can offer a repair product that is for your particular issue to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ation or walls. If the problem is a sloping foundation, we can implement a series of foundation piers to correct the problem. We will install either push piers or helical piers, depending on where and how bad the sinking is. Both types are very strong and can stabilize your foundation.
